President Trump and his Russian counterpart Vladimir Putin will arrive in Alaska today with two very different goals in mind for how to end the war in Ukraine. voice-verified
After initially playing down the summit as a way to feel out Putin's position, Trump in recent days has said he would urge Putin to accept a ceasefire, seeking to jumpstart long-stalled negotiations with voice-verified
For Putin, the aim when the leaders meet at an airbase outside of Anchorage will be to stay in Trump's good graces while still trying to reassert Moscow's dominance over Kyiv. voice-verified
Speaking to reporters at the White House, Trump said he wants to bring Ukrainian President Volodymyr Zelensky into the talks. voice-verified
But while Trump is aiming to move quickly to bring an end to the war, journal correspondent Thomas Grove says Putin will be happy to play the long game. voice-verified
